One of the most significant benefits of virtual reality is its ability to simulate real-life scenarios. In medical care, this can be particularly useful in training medical professionals. VR can create simulated environments that mimic real-life medical situations, allowing healthcare professionals to practice and develop their skills in a safe and controlled environment. For example, surgeons can use VR to simulate complex surgeries, enabling them to practice and perfect their techniques before performing them on real patients.
In addition to training, virtual reality can also be used for medical education. Medical students can use VR to explore and learn about complex anatomy and physiology, allowing them to understand how the human body works in a more interactive and immersive way. VR can also be used to help patients understand their medical conditions and treatments. For example, patients with chronic pain can use VR to learn about the source of their pain and the treatments that are available.
Another significant benefit of virtual reality in medical care is its ability to reduce patient anxiety and pain. VR has been used to distract patients during medical procedures, reducing the need for anesthesia and pain medication. Studies have shown that patients who used VR during medical procedures reported less pain and anxiety, and even lower levels of nausea and dizziness.
Virtual reality can also be used to treat a wide range of mental health conditions. For example, VR has been used to treat post-traumatic stress disorder (PTSD), anxiety, and depression. VR therapy involves creating virtual environments that allow patients to face and overcome their fears or phobias in a controlled environment. This type of therapy has shown promising results, with patients reporting a significant reduction in symptoms after treatment.
